GSM Rating: The Most Important Spec

GSM (grams per square meter) tells you the towel's density and softness. For drying: 300–450 GSM works well. For polishing and buffing: 600–800 GSM. The Rag Company Edgeless 365 hits 365 GSM—a versatile choice. Avoid bargain packs under 200 GSM; they leave lint and cause micro-scratches.

Edgeless vs. Silk-Edged Construction

Edgeless towels eliminate the stitched border that scratches clear coat. If you're detailing paint or windows, edgeless is non-negotiable. Chemical Guys' Waffle Weave uses a silk border—safe for most surfaces but keep it off freshly polished panels. Amazon Basics towels have standard stitching; reserve them for interior and wheels where scratching isn't a concern.

Blend Matters: 70/30 vs. 80/20

Most quality towels use a 70% polyester / 30% polyamide blend. The polyamide (nylon) component adds softness and water-wicking. The 80/20 blend in some budget options is less effective at lifting dirt. Meguiar's Water Magnet uses a premium blend engineered specifically for pulling water off glass and paint in a single pass.

Washing and Longevity

Microfiber must be washed separately from cotton towels and without fabric softener—softener clogs the fibers and kills absorbency permanently. Wash in cold or warm water (never hot). A 12-pack or 24-pack is the right buy; you'll always have dry towels ready and can rotate properly through wash cycles.

Frequently Asked Questions

What GSM is best for drying a car?
300–450 GSM is ideal for drying. Go 600+ GSM for polishing or paint correction work where you need extra softness and cushion.
Can I use paper towels or terry cloth on car paint?
No. Both cause micro-scratches. Only use dedicated automotive microfiber on painted surfaces.
How do I wash microfiber towels?
Cold or warm machine wash, no fabric softener, no bleach. Tumble dry low or air dry. Never mix with cotton towels.
What's the difference between drying and detailing towels?
Drying towels are large and absorbent (waffle or plush weave). Detailing towels are smaller and softer (400–600 GSM) for applying products or buffing residue.
